Across 12 games this season, Detroit Lions quarterback Jared Goff has completed 69.8% of his pass attempts for 3,025 yards, 25 touchdowns, and five interceptions. However, his supporting cast in Detroit is as depleted as it's been all season heading into his Week 14 matchup against the Dallas Cowboys. The Lions will be without tight ends Brock Wright (neck) and Sam LaPorta (back), as well as wide receiver Kalif Raymond (ankle). Most importantly, star wideout Amon-Ra St. Brown (ankle) did not practice all week and is questionable to play against Dallas due to the low ankle sprain he suffered in Week 13. On paper, the Cowboys look like a favorable matchup for Goff. Through 13 weeks, Dallas has allowed the most passing yards (3,234) and touchdowns (28) of any NFL team. The Cowboys have been better in the second half of the season, but they still allowed four touchdown passes in Week 13 to the Kansas City Chiefs. While his outlook would obviously be improved if St. Brown is active, Goff profiles as a solid fantasy QB1 in Week 14.

Arizona Cardinals head coach Jonathan Gannon said on Monday that surgery isn't currently on the table for quarterback Kyler Murray (foot), according to Tyler Drake of Arizona Sports. "To my knowledge, not right now. That's as honest as I can answer it. I have not heard that. No," Gannon said. Murray is eligible to be activated from Injured Reserve, but the Cardinals will not open his 21-day practice window this week because he's simply not ready to return to practice following his foot sprain back in the Week 5 loss to the Tennessee Titans. The 28-year-old will not return this week when the team faces the division-rival Los Angeles Rams, and it remains to be seen if he'll be in play for Week 15 versus the Houston Texans. The Cardinals have been non-committal on whether Murray will even take the starting QB job back from Jacoby Brissett, who has led a much more explosive offensive attack with Murray sidelined.
